The Philadelphia Eagles aren’t the same team that stunned the football world by beating the New England Patriots in Super Bowl 53. This group is struggling to find its way, which might be putting it mildly, and now fighting for whatever slim odds it has left to reach the NFC playoffs. The Eagles barely put up a fight in a 48-7 loss to the New Orleans Saints. It was a performance that reinforced how far the team has to go, sitting at 4-6 while offering little reason to believe a quick turnaround is imminent. Injuries have stood in the way of consistency, and significant issues remain on both the offensive and defensive sides of the ball. A key three-game stretch lies ahead beginning with the New York Giants. Any road to the playoff likely must start with wins in all three.
